In an RLC circuit a second capacitor is addedin series to the capacitor already present. (a) Does the resonancefrequency increase, decrease, or stay the same? (b) Choose the bestexplanation from among the following:I. The resonance frequency stays the same because it dependsonly on the resistance in the circuit.II. Adding a capacitor in series increases the equivalent capacitance, and this decreases the resonance frequency.III. Adding a capacitor in series decreases the equivalent capacitance, and this increases the resonance frequency.
